An Digital Oar for Controlling an Digital Kayak



Let’s say that, hypothetically, you had been to construct an digital kayak. That dangerous boy would possibly — in idea — have an electrical motor with a propeller to make the kayak zip by way of the water. And perhaps it may even embody some form of machine studying mannequin, so AI is aware of when to spin the motor to help with paddling, type of like a contemporary e-bike. That every one sounds fairly cool, however how do you management it? Braden Sunwold truly constructed this hypothetical e-kayak and his answer was to construct this digital oar to regulate it.

This looks like a extremely apparent answer looking back, which is why it’s so intelligent. Regardless that the e-kayak’s electrical motor can present propulsion, the person continues to be going to wish a paddle. On the very least, they’ll want that for altering course and positive changes. And it’s probably they are going to do some paddling to complement the motor, too. As an alternative of fumbling round with a smartphone or some type of throttle field after they’re within the water, the person can simply press a button on the paddle. Extra importantly, the e-kayak can pull knowledge from the paddle to assist the machine studying mannequin decide how a lot energy to present the motor and when.

It was essential to create a water-resistant enclosure for the digital parts and Sunwold turned to his buddy, Jordan Godoy, for assist with that. Jordan created a 3D mannequin after which 3D-printed it. The enclosure is cylindrical to permit for using a regular o-ring seal. Clamps let it safe to the paddle’s shaft. A button on one finish of the enclosure lets the person alter velocity and an Adafruit NeoPixel LED ring shines by way of the 3D-printed plastic to supply suggestions.

Inside that enclosure, there’s an Adafruit Feather M0 Primary Proto improvement board. It collects knowledge from the button and a BNO085 IMU. It then sends the info to the e-kayak’s Raspberry Pi 4 Mannequin B controller by way of nRF24 radio frequency transceivers. From there, it’s as much as the e-kayak’s Raspberry Pi to find out what to do with the motor. In computerized mode, it makes use of the machine studying mannequin to try to help the person’s paddling in a pure method. In handbook mode, it merely supplies thrust and the person can push the button on the paddle to alter the velocity.

Sunwold nonetheless has some extra work to do to refine this idea and construct a sensible e-kayak, however he’s effectively on his method and this digital oar is a giant step ahead.
